Hello,
I am setting up thunderbird, but got the message "failed to find settings for your e-mail account".
I tried the following:
Type the values in the following fields:
Incoming: mypost.yorku.ca
From the pull-down menu select "IMAP"
Next field change to "993"
From the pull-down menu select "SSL/TLS"
Outgoing: mailrelay.yorku.ca
SMTP field type "587"
From the pull-down menu select "STARTTLS"
...still no success.
What else do I need to do?
Thank you.

Re: failed to find settings for e-mail account
You should be, but many firewalls won't prompt you if it's an upgrade to the program. It will see the change and block it, but because it's already listed, it won't ask.
How you grant access depends on which firewall you're using.
